Reviewer 1 Report

The manuscript “Influence of Anthropogenic Factors on the Diversity and Structure of a Dry Forest in the Central Part of Tumbesian Region (Ecuador–Perú)” described the diversity and structural characteristics of the Dry Forest in southern Ecuador and northern Peru, and analyze the effect of anthropogenic and abiotic factors on variables related with forest structure and composition.

The topic is interesting and relevant for understanding the impacts of human activities on structural aspects of dry forest, a poorly and extended ecosystem in South America.

The introduction needs some restructuration. The sampling design and data analysis is suitable and consistent with the objectives. The results and discussion needs some revision to make these sections clearer.

I am not a native English speaker but I consider that the manuscript needs a language revision as some expressions are not proper.

Regarding the selection of the model, I consider you should select one model per response variable, taking into account that the decision of including a predictor variable in the model is not only related with the model fitness but with the question you want to answer. The importance of a predictor in your results is related with the significance of the effect on your response variable not with the model fitness. Then, as an example, domestic animals had no effect on anyone of your response variables in spite of these variables were included in models with better fitness.

Also, I strongly suggest avoiding speculative comments throughout the results and to move these comments to the section “discussion”.

Discussion

I have a few general comments about the discussion. I agree that the HPI was the most important predictor influencing the studies variables. It would be important to discuss what kind of human activity could be more related with the HPI. What are the main activities in the area? Is livestock grazing a common activity in the villages? Is the logging in the area for commercial purposes implying selective logging or is it for providing firewood? I consider it could help to interpret the results.

I strongly suggest being careful with the discussion of cattle effects because there was no effect. There would be many reasons for the absence of an effect, for example, the range of livestock densities covered by samplings could be not enough to detect the effects. Is the amount of feces a good estimator of livestock pressure? It is a common estimator but it can be variable considering the decomposition rate of the site. You should point that results regarding livestock were unclear.

Reviewer 2 Report

In general, the paper offers a valuable contribution to a better understanding of humans on the dry forest. It also shows an extensive fieldwork assessment and a detailed and appropriate statistical approach. However, it shows several issues in terms of formatting, writing style and edition. I will number the most common issues and then point most of them in a more detailed fashion. Since the importance of the topic is invaluable, I encourage the author to take the proper steps to improve the quality of this paper.

 

Style

Paragraphs usually start with a topic sentence which is developed further in the body. But in this paper, it is common to find citations at the beginning of the paragraphs. In order to transmit your message more efficiently, start with the subject or topic, and finish with the citations, this way the reader will prioritize the information instead of the authorship. Moreover, MDPI has a very defined style to cite which reduces the need for writing long lists of authors in the body, thus improving the reader experience. Has this paper also been sent to other journals with the “author, year” format in the body of the article? Or does it come from a thesis?
